Frequently Asked Questions
- Who wins the Data Duel between Panama and Argentina?
- Panama wins the Data Duel 6-4 across the 12 indicators compared. The comparison covers GDP, population, life expectancy, CO₂ emissions, and 8 more indicators sourced from the World Bank.
- How do Panama and Argentina compare on GDP?
- Panama has a GDP of $86.3 billion, while Argentina has $633.3 billion. Argentina leads on this indicator.
- How do Panama and Argentina compare on GDP per Capita?
- Panama has a GDP per Capita of $19,102.852, while Argentina has $13,858.204. Panama leads on this indicator.
- How do Panama and Argentina compare on Population?
- Panama has a Population of 4.5 million, while Argentina has 45.7 million. they are comparable on this indicator.
- How do Panama and Argentina compare on Life Expectancy?
- Panama has a Life Expectancy of 79.6, while Argentina has 77.4. Panama leads on this indicator.
- How do Panama and Argentina compare on GDP Growth?
- Panama has a GDP Growth of 2.9%, while Argentina has -1.7%. Panama leads on this indicator.
